We just returned from a 5 day safari to Ngorongoro Crater and the Serengetti. I've never seen so many animals - best of all the giraffes! We even saw cheetas - and their kill - many lions - so close you felt like you could reach out and touch them! We had a super guide/translator/driver who saw animals before anyone else. The sunset on the Serengetti was spectacular! I can't download any pictures today because the internet is not quite what we are used to in the US. But at least they have it - and everyone has cell phones too. We visited a Masaii boma which was an experience in itself. I'm out of time today but will try to post some pictures soon.
